bgk0018 / refactoring-cheat-sheet
This is a cheat sheet I wanted to create in order to familiarize myself with Martin Fowler's refactorings from "Refactoring, Improving the Design of Existing Code"
☆47Updated 7 years ago
Alternatives and similar repositories for refactoring-cheat-sheet:
Users that are interested in refactoring-cheat-sheet are comparing it to the libraries listed below
- A place to practice Refactoring To Patterns that Kerievsky wrote about in his book☆72Updated 2 years ago
- Test-Driven Development - Extensive Tutorial. Open Source ebook☆367Updated 2 months ago
- A curated list of Domain-Driven Design (DDD), Command Query Responsibility Segregation (CQRS), Event Sourcing, and Event Storming resourc…☆74Updated 3 years ago
- Coding practice demonstrating an awfully long method. Try to refactor this method.☆40Updated 3 years ago
- Optimize the value of your tests by choosing how to tradeoff among various valuable properties.☆219Updated last month
- Hosts the code developed in the coding tutorials at https://www.youtube.com/c/AboutCleanCode☆49Updated this week
- Refactor developer habits: among many such habits when writing or maintaining code☆137Updated 5 years ago
- For practicing refactoring, removing duplication, and making code more flexible☆19Updated 4 years ago
- A collection of TDD exercises that are useful as katas☆73Updated 8 years ago
- My reading notes following "Software Architecture Patterns" report by Mark Richards.☆60Updated 3 years ago
- A complete Code Smells reference☆95Updated 3 years ago
- The Expense Report example from cleancoders.com episode 10☆58Updated 12 years ago
- the goal is to practice refactoring to a Chain of Responsibility pattern☆18Updated 9 months ago
- Patterns of Enterprise Application Architecture☆47Updated 6 years ago
- ☆49Updated 11 months ago
- Notes taken while reading interesting books and they are too large to be published in the blog☆18Updated 5 years ago
- ☆12Updated 3 years ago
- Software Architecture for Busy Developers, published by Packt☆48Updated 2 years ago
- ☆52Updated last month
- Designing a Microservices Architecture☆107Updated 5 years ago
- Microservices, Go, Kotlin, Domain-driven design, Reactive, Apache Kafka, Kubernetes, Serverless, Conference videos...☆120Updated last year
- Code dojos☆113Updated 11 months ago
- The videostore example from Martin Fowler's Refactoring, and from Episode 3 of cleancoders.com☆89Updated 3 years ago
- A set of resources to become a Practical Software Architect: decision making, efficient meetings, architecture guide, etc.☆98Updated 5 years ago
- Example from first chapter of 'Refactoring' by Martin Fowler, with tests and translations☆206Updated this week
- ☆149Updated 6 years ago
- Everything you need to conduct an introductory workshop on test-driven development.☆133Updated 2 years ago
- C# Data Structures and Algorithms [video], published by Packt☆23Updated 2 years ago
- This project has some sample code for my personal learning purpose. Things which I've learnead are collected as issues here: https://gith…☆107Updated 10 months ago
- exercise for practicing refactoring☆23Updated 8 months ago